DataAnnotation is committed to creating high‑quality AI. We are looking for an Investment Research Analyst to join our team to help train the next generation of AI while enjoying the flexibility of remote work and the freedom to set your own schedule. This role is designed to fit a variety of lifestyles – whether you’re looking to contribute part‑time alongside a current position, pursue it full‑time, or engage periodically as a flexible professional opportunity. We’re currently expanding into an exciting new area – teaching AI Assistant models to be a more useful tool for finance professionals.

We’re seeking experienced finance professionals with advanced degrees (MBA+) and professional experience to use their expertise to help shape how AI understands financial principles and decision‑making. We’re growing a team of finance experts, and as the team grows, so will your opportunities.

In this role, You Might:

  • Review and improve AI Assistant answers to questions about macro trends, corporate finance, and capital markets.
  • Leverage your education and work experience to check the reasoning and accuracy of an AI Assistant’s work.
  • Push the models with complex, real‑world scenarios and edge cases to see where their reasoning holds up – and where it doesn’t.
  • Share clear, structured feedback to help make each new version of the AI smarter and more reliable.

To succeed in this position, you should have:

  • Expert‑level financial reasoning and formal training in a finance‑related discipline.
  • A Master’s or PhD (completed or in progress) is strongly preferred.
  • Relevant backgrounds include Financial Accounting, Investment Banking, Corporate Development, Wealth Management, and Insurance Planning.

Benefits:

  • This is a full‑time or part‑time REMOTE position.
  • You’ll be able to choose which projects you want to work on.
  • You can work on your own schedule.
  • Projects are paid hourly starting at USD $50‑$60 per hour, with bonuses on high‑volume work.
